The Dockweiler State Beach is a state park and protected beach in Playa del Ray, California. It is located right next to the Los Angeles International Airport.

Noted for being one of the few beaches in Los Angeles County to allow bonfires, the Dockweiler State Beach is a pretty popular destination all year round. A lot of people actually enjoy going to the site to swim, surf, and have some barbeques on any of the several concrete pits that are available on the site. It is said that it creates a very unique experience, as you get to relax by the waters in a backdrop of aircraft takeoffs. Another interesting attraction of the park is its hang gliding flight training area.
